WebStandard progressive lenses are manufactured for standardized parameters like the distance between your eyes and how the glasses sit in your face. Premium progressive lenses can be manufactured … WebStandard and premium progressive lenses offer similar benefits for your eyes, such as clearing up your vision at three distances. However, you may prefer one option over the other based on your budget and visual needs. … great west life toll free phone number

WebImpact-resistant Lenses. Thinner and lighter than plastic, polycarbonate (impact-resistant) lenses are shatter-proof and provide 100% UV protection, making them the optimal choice for kids and active adults.
